Job description

Job Summary: The Phlebotomist conducts specimen collection and processing with an emphasis on accuracy, timeliness, completeness, safety, and compliance while maintaining a professional image and adhering to our Service Excellence Standards and Core Values.

  • Follow proper specimen identification procedures during specimen collection and labeling.
  • Collects, prepares, processes, stores and/or transports specimens using correct techniques and anticoagulants.
  • Perform routine monitoring of temperatures for refrigerators, freezers and microbiology incubator(s).
  • Receive incoming phone calls, documents and follow through on incoming requests.
  • Investigate, document, and resolve specimen issues to ensure timely and accurate reporting of results.
  • Performs a variety of clerical duties and housekeeping tasks involved in maintaining the laboratory in a clean, orderly, and safe condition to include assisting in ordering supplies.
  • Train new students, staff and document proficiency as directed.
  • Effectively use computer options relevant to job duties.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Requirements: High school diploma

Completion of an accredited phlebotomy program

About Us

Founded in 1906, McLeod Health is a locally owned and managed, not for profit organization supported by the strength of more than 900 members on its medical staff and more than 2,900 licensed nurses. McLeod Health is also composed of approximately 15,000 team members and more than 90 physician practices throughout its 18-county service area. With seven hospitals, McLeod Health operates three Health and Fitness Centers, a Sports Medicine and Outpatient Rehabilitation Center, Hospice and Home Health Services. The system currently has 988 licensed beds, including Hospice and Behavioral Health. The hospitals within McLeod Health include: McLeod Regional Medical Center, McLeod Health Dillon, McLeod Health Loris, McLeod Health Seacoast, McLeod Health Cheraw, McLeod Health Clarendon and McLeod Behavioral Health.
